找回密码
 注册

QQ登录

只需一步,快速开始

扫一扫,访问微社区

巢课
电巢直播8月计划
查看: 968|回复: 11
打印 上一主题 下一主题

请mentor用过一段时间的人来解决下这个问题!

[复制链接]

7

主题

94

帖子

440

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
440
跳转到指定楼层
1#
发表于 2013-11-28 14:29 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
3E币
之前建库的时候,某些元器件封装做得不合适,需要改尺寸,但是该cell又没其他的part占用,所以只能另作part(不能直接改cell,要不然直接在ee中update cell一下就可以用了)。由于之前的工程用的该part,所以就不删除了,要不然会重改很多工程。现在为了方便识别该part,于是我还采用原来的part名字,命名成如此模样xx_1,在dxdesigner中升级库,导入新作part,package with new library,在ee中forward也是new library,结果还是原来的cell,请问如何解决?
- g" b9 G3 h# H- |3 U本人级别不高,先暂定为3金币吧+ ?9 X9 k: T. v. |& x9 @
附:我改成其他名字再重复上述操作,貌似直接ok!不改情况下如何解决?不解决它耽误我半小时一小时的功夫,我的时间啊 !!!

最佳答案

查看完整内容

你正文中说的是"但是该cell又没其他的part占用",难怪别人会误解. MENTOR建库需要提前规划好命名规则。你这样临时用XX_1的形式,只能解决一时,后面长期看来真的不方便使用及管理。 时间久了,整个库很混乱,无论是管理库的人还是使用的人容易搞错。 还是要确认下PART,看看是否真的分配正确。 另外一个可能性非常大的原因,这个很可能XX_1这种格式,属于特殊符号格式,导致虽然分配了软件不会首先识别XX_1,而是先识别XX。 ...
分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友 微信微信
收藏收藏 支持!支持! 反对!反对!

40

主题

465

帖子

6807

积分

五级会员(50)

Rank: 5

积分
6807
2#
发表于 2013-11-28 14:29 | 只看该作者
本帖最后由 dallacsu 于 2013-12-3 17:19 编辑 4 Q- D, ^. e& [; Y0 Z
, s( k. u' b, `( k! a. T
你正文中说的是"但是该cell又没其他的part占用",难怪别人会误解.
  p5 A0 f6 d" B, P+ ?5 ^# M' q! Y3 a8 I5 s
MENTOR建库需要提前规划好命名规则。你这样临时用XX_1的形式,只能解决一时,后面长期看来真的不方便使用及管理。% v  z: E, j4 P7 ^( s! p
时间久了,整个库很混乱,无论是管理库的人还是使用的人容易搞错。
4 @5 H/ K6 Q% O; U
0 o; A! D8 h: n# S4 J$ i还是要确认下PART,看看是否真的分配正确。
, l2 m( r5 @9 C& U1 O
) o. a$ \2 Y/ C) l7 V( s$ B另外一个可能性非常大的原因,这个很可能XX_1这种格式,属于特殊符号格式,导致虽然分配了软件不会首先识别XX_1,而是先识别XX。命名格式暗中导致了一个优先级顺序。
# B) x# `* @  o9 n! E9 ]8 p7 S' i, J: e8 T9 z( `! O1 |
比如在symbol里面,一个PART要分配多个symbol符号,命名格式是XX.1,XX.2等,猜测(未验证)一定程度上软件会将"."识别为"_",与PADS库不同,MENTOR不太支持特殊符号的识别,尤其是cell命名里面,很多特殊符号不支持的(命名中非法符号都有提示,建库的应该知道)。这也是为什么你换个名字就OK的原因。7 H( v' d& H' t, k! c5 a7 F$ D( k

$ V5 A$ s% Q4 [
从此开始自己的美丽人生

7

主题

94

帖子

440

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
440
3#
 楼主| 发表于 2013-11-29 14:11 | 只看该作者
为什么我发的帖子没人回啊

0

主题

9

帖子

-8949

积分

未知游客(0)

积分
-8949
4#
发表于 2013-11-30 16:05 | 只看该作者
可以在原来的基础上修改cell,以前的工程不更新就可以;
' @9 N( z( f- W+ O7 s  }! H5 X名字只是个符号,但是有些字符不合法,注意使用;
) f, z# A9 O/ k) H) x" a" @: Y导致更新后还是原来的cell的原因,是你做part的原因,看用的是不是新做的cell呀!主要还是检查part;

7

主题

94

帖子

440

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
440
5#
 楼主| 发表于 2013-12-2 10:01 | 只看该作者
xiaoweiniu 发表于 2013-11-30 16:054 `! D9 O+ p. n9 d
可以在原来的基础上修改cell,以前的工程不更新就可以;* }6 D2 R% z5 D" q
名字只是个符号,但是有些字符不合法,注意使用; ...

2 y6 V& U0 _5 d+ v+ v) I谢谢你,修改cell固然是很容易解决问题。不过你可能没看清楚,我说的是该cell还关联着其他的part,而其他的part的cell就是该尺寸,该cell,不能改变。是我引用的原来别人的library里就把cell跟symbol已经组成了这个错误的part,我一旦把cell改了,其他的不能更改的part就都被改动了。。。

13

主题

55

帖子

261

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
261
6#
发表于 2013-12-3 14:45 | 只看该作者
prince_王 发表于 2013-11-29 14:11  s( H/ K5 S- T* {- P, g
为什么我发的帖子没人回啊
7 f9 y+ J% f/ z) S# F1 S. E
我看了,但是不会,你懂得,呵呵

7

主题

94

帖子

440

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
440
7#
 楼主| 发表于 2013-12-3 17:29 | 只看该作者
dallacsu 发表于 2013-12-3 17:17- w. h: b+ V$ V2 [. q
你正文中说的是"但是该cell又没其他的part占用",难怪别人会误解.
9 d* L# \6 R7 o
! M9 ?! ?$ L7 ^2 v/ RMENTOR建库需要提前规划好命名规则。你 ...

1 x: k* ]1 ]1 U! W5 Y5 U: R) e好吧,对库进行大整理吧。谢谢你!虽然没有在那个基础上解决问题,但是给你了。进来看的人多,回复的少啊,mentor群不太积极啊

9

主题

112

帖子

968

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
968
8#
发表于 2013-12-5 10:34 | 只看该作者
我的库里面也因为有类似问题有“_1"的part,所以我可以确定”_1“的命名方式绝对是可以使用的。( v# w# H$ p5 y$ {5 O3 I& }  |. P
我刚刚又重新新建了”_1“的part,也没有遇到楼主的问题。
4 O, i% m7 W) J% `7 N# O. z$ |楼主的cell是怎么修改命名的呢。
( L7 ?/ @( ~4 V5 B. a# y/ O& J& R3 W9 Z

7

主题

94

帖子

440

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
440
9#
 楼主| 发表于 2013-12-5 13:22 | 只看该作者
lalasa1987 发表于 2013-12-5 10:34! c% y. r1 d9 P7 i9 _1 y8 m
我的库里面也因为有类似问题有“_1"的part,所以我可以确定”_1“的命名方式绝对是可以使用的。& t8 M; u, U3 G% Z, a+ D3 B7 y
我刚刚又 ...
" D3 B& X3 j& L8 _: b
cell是重新命名的,问题肯定不在这里。我库里也有xx_1的part可以使用的,前提可能是在原理图中未调用过的吧?一旦调用,再出现类似xx_1的part好像就不行了呢

9

主题

112

帖子

968

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
968
10#
发表于 2013-12-6 10:37 | 只看该作者
prince_王 发表于 2013-12-5 13:22
! E# b# |0 W  Zcell是重新命名的,问题肯定不在这里。我库里也有xx_1的part可以使用的,前提可能是在原理图中未调用过的 ...

+ R: i* x$ j, d3 P/ D5 C我先用之前的,然后导入PCB后。再删掉元器件,用“_1”的替代,然后再导入PCB,还是可行的呀= =

2

主题

113

帖子

321

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
321
11#
发表于 2013-12-11 17:15 | 只看该作者
其实这个是一个对应关系,要是你想更改一个cell,先要看看有哪一些part有用。要是更改cell,那么所有的引用到的part都会更改,要是只想改某一个part之对应的cell那么只能复制一个更改(重新做一个)名字或不同分区

7

主题

94

帖子

440

积分

三级会员(30)

Rank: 3Rank: 3Rank: 3

积分
440
12#
 楼主| 发表于 2013-12-16 09:04 | 只看该作者
hunterwang 发表于 2013-12-11 17:15" X- O  N1 t+ L
其实这个是一个对应关系,要是你想更改一个cell,先要看看有哪一些part有用。要是更改cell,那么所有的引用到 ...

4 ~  V1 h. Y( v6 a  k! B是,反正各步操作都得规范啊,呵呵
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

推荐内容上一条 /1 下一条

巢课

技术风云榜

关于我们|手机版|EDA365 ( 粤ICP备18020198号 )

GMT+8, 2024-11-28 01:26 , Processed in 0.074961 second(s), 33 queries , Gzip On.

深圳市墨知创新科技有限公司

地址:深圳市南山区科技生态园2栋A座805 电话:19926409050

快速回复 返回顶部 返回列表